Handover for the new contractor on Seedsmith, our test-data factory library. The factories live under /factories, with traits composed via the builder in core.rb. Known gap: nested associations sometimes double-create parents — fix is half-done on the branch noted in the tracker. Please run the full suite before merging anything. The maintainer vault holding the signing key opens with the passphrase below.

vault phrase of bagaf-kajeg = jorath-feniel-briir-siliel-ralix

Re: fuel-usage rollup in `fleetreport/aggregate.py` — the Haulwick telemetry feed is unauthenticated at this layer, so clamp inputs before aggregation. Negative liters and absurd odometer deltas currently pass straight through to the weekly report. Also, the per-vehicle cache never expires; stale entries can mask tampered readings. Cap the window size, reject out-of-range samples, and log discards. I've pulled the bounds we enforce elsewhere so you can audit them here.

tuning constants:
QUOTAS = {
    "druwyn": 5,
    "holix": 5,
    "zorath": 5,
    "holwyn": 10,
}

Break-Glass Access — Drossmere Ledger DB

The ledger table is partitioned by month; break-glass access grants read on the current partition only. Use it only when the proxy is down and a customer case is blocking. Log the incident number first. The break-glass terminal prompts for the emergency recovery passphrase. Enter the passphrase exactly as recorded below.

unlock words, faweg-fahop: wendor-kelmir-ulaeth-holael

To the release manager: I'm passing ownership of the Pellwick deep-link router to Sorrel before the 4.2 cut. The intent-matching table now lives in the Farrowgate config service; stale entries were purged last sprint. Watch the fallback route — it silently swallows malformed slugs, which inflated our drop-off metrics in March. The staging resolver needs its keystore unlocked before each regression pass, and that keystore accepts only one credential. For the signing vault, the recovery phrase is noted directly below.

recovery phrase for tafog-fafog: novix-novdor-fraath-brieth-olieth-oliix-rusix-wenion-julax-druox